Creating therapy based on assessments
Every child learns and responds differently. The process begins with detailed assessments that reveal communication abilities, behavior patterns, and daily routines. These findings form the foundation of therapy. With accurate assessments, therapists create goals that fit the child’s learning style and environment. Parents often feel reassured knowing therapy is based on observation and data, not a one-size-fits-all method.

Building independence in routines
Daily activities like eating, dressing, or following schedules can sometimes feel overwhelming. Therapy breaks these routines into smaller steps, allowing children to learn gradually. Each success builds confidence, helping children gain independence in daily life. Families also experience smoother routines and less stress, making daily living more enjoyable for everyone.

Tracking growth and making changes
Individualized ABA treatment is not fixed. Progress is tracked regularly through reassessments, and goals are adjusted as children grow and change. This ongoing process ensures therapy always meets the child’s needs. Families appreciate being able to see measurable improvements, which strengthens trust and commitment to the therapy journey.
